Do you need snow tires on AWD?

0 views

Related questions

Tags

  1. #slick
  2. #driving
  3. #blizzard
  4. #common
  5. #tanks
  6. #conditions
  7. #chains
  8. #season
  9. #either
  10. #misperception
  11. #moderate
  12. #probably
  13. #winter
  14. #wheel
  15. #drive
  16. #light
  17. #safely
  18. #tires
  19. #recommended